Brief Summary

This is a parallel assigned, open-label, perspective trial studying the safety and efficacy of intensity-modulated radiotherapy (IMRT) combined with PD-1 Blockade and Lenvatinib for Hepatocellular Carcinoma (HCC) with Vp3 Portal Vein Tumor Thrombus (PVTT, Japanese Liver Cancer Study Group classification) before liver transplantation.

Detailed Description

In most criteria (e.g.Milan, UCSF, Up-to-seven), PVTT remains as an absolute contraindication for liver transplant due to the high rate of recurrence and poor prognosis. Neoadjuvant therapy has induced pathological responses in multiple tumor types and might decrease the risk of postoperative recurrence in HCC. The primary endpoint is the necrosis rate of PVTT and the primary tumor.

Participants receive PD-1 Blockade (Pembrolizumab,Sintilimab, Camrelizumab,Tislelizumab) 200 mg intravenously on day 1 of a regular treatment cycle and Lenvatinib Mesylate Capsule (Lenvima®) 8 mg orally once daily. Neoadjuvant IMRT will be initiated at the third treatment cycle, and the dose prescription of IMRT is for planning target volume (PTV). The prescription dose to 95%PTV should be ≥50 Gy and ≤60 Gy, and been given in daily dose fractions of 2 Gy, 5 days per week. And the final prescription dose is determined according to dose constraints for organs at risk.

Inclusion Criteria
  • Patients must have pathologically or cytologically or by radiological criteria proven hepatocellular carcinoma(exceeding Milan criteria); known mixed histology (e.g. hepatocellular carcinoma plus cholangiocarcinoma) or fibrolamellar variant is not allowed.
  • The maximum diameter of a single tumor ≤9cm. Or the number of tumors ≤3 and the maximum diameter of the largest tumors ≤5cm, and the sum of the maximum diameters of all tumors ≤9cm.
  • Vp3 PVTT according to Japanese Vp classification.
  • Without lymph node metastasis or extrahepatic metastasis.
  • Baseline AFP≥20ng/ mL
  • Has an eligibility scan (CT of the chest, triphasic CT scan and MRI of the abdomen) <1 week before the treatment.
  • Has an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1 within 7 days prior to Cycle 1, Day 1.
  • Has a Child-Pugh A-B7 liver score (5 to 7 points) within 7 days prior to Cycle 1, Day 1.
  • Laboratory tests within 7 days prior to Cycle 1, Day 1:
  • Neutrophils ≥1.5×109/L
  • Hemoglobin ≥8.5g/dL
  • Platelets ≥100×109/L,
  • Creatinine ≤1.5× upper limit of normal (ULN) and endogenous creatinine clearance ≥50ml/min (standard Cockcroft Gaul formula)
  • Total bilirubin ≤3×ULN, ALT≤5×ULN, AST≤5×ULN, INR≤1.7
  • Has controlled hepatitis B (HBV-DNA<105IU/ml)
  • The estimate time length between enrollment and liver transplantation should be at least 3 months.
  • No prior systematic therapy such as immunotherapy, targeted therapy and chemotherapy for HCC.
  • No prior local treatment such as TACE, HAIC, radiofrequency ablation or radiotherapy was received within 2 months before enrollment.
  • If female, is not pregnant or breastfeeding, and at least one of the following conditions applies: 1) Is not a woman of childbearing potential (WOCBP); or 2) Is a WOCBP and using a contraceptive method that is highly effective or be abstinent from heterosexual intercourse as their preferred and usual lifestyle (a WOCBP must have a negative pregnancy test within 72 hours before the first dose of study treatment).
  • No obvious insufficiency of other organs.
  • Patients with a history of hypertension should be well controlled (< 140/90 mmHg) on a regimen of anti-hypertensive therapy.
  • Patients voluntarily joined the study and signed informed consent with good compliance and follow-up.

Secondary Outcome Measures
NameTimeMethod
Objective Response Rate (ORR)up to 12 months

RR is defined as the proportion of patients whose tumor volume has reached a predetermined value and can maintain a minimum time limit, including complete response(CR) and partial response(PR) by independent radiologic review according to mRECIST criteria.

Progression-free survival (PFS)up to 12 months

PFS is defined as the time from the date of treatment initiation to the date of the first observation of progressive disease (PD) by independent radiologic review according to mRECIST criteria or death from any cause.

Time to Progression (TTP)up to 12 months

TTP is defined as the duration from the date of patient recruited to the first progress at any site or the date of death from any cause.

Alpha Fetoprotein Response (AFP-R)up to 12 months

AFP-R is defined as a \>20% decrease in AFP serum level from baseline to the time of liver transplant, if liver transplant is not possible, the final AFP level would be measured as the AFP level at 12 months.

Duration of response (DOR)up to 12 months

DOR is defined as the duration from the date that measurement criteria are met for CR or PR to the first progress at any site or the date of death from any cause.
